When comparing aerogel insulation films to traditional materials, the differences are significant. Traditional insulations, like fiberglass and foam, often require more space. They may not provide the same level of thermal resistance as aerogel. Aerogel insulation is incredibly lightweight and has a high insulating value. This means it can fit into tighter spaces while still performing efficiently.
Aerogel films are known for their low thermal conductivity. This property offers remarkable energy savings over time. However, aerogel films can be more expensive upfront. Some builders hesitate due to cost.
Furthermore, while aerogel is strong, it’s also delicate. Care must be taken during handling and installation.
Consumers often wonder about long-term reliability. Aerogel has shown great promise across various applications, but research is ongoing. Storms and extreme temperatures can affect performance. Understanding these nuances is essential for making informed choices.
